1) Archipelago of Seychelles
This is an area of a hundred islands in the midst of the Indian Ocean. Most American travelers do not even know that this breathtaking area exists but other tourists from various other areas of the world have discovered its beauty. The Anse Source d'Argent area actually sports pink sands which are beautiful and quite unique. It is a definite must see for any tourist.

5) Plage Malendure on Basse-Terre, Guadalupe
This is a black beach that sits at the base of the volcano La SoufriƩre. It sits by the Jacques Cousteau Underwater Park which is considered to be one of the best diving sites in the Caribbean.
6) Tulum south of Cancun
This beach is not nearly as crowded as its Northern neighbors. It actually has beach Mayan ruins which are unique to explore. The white beaches are lovely. This is the perfect location to enjoy privacy and seclusion.

10) Owen Island, Little Cayman, Cayman Islands
The island of Little Cayman is home to under 200 people. Here the beaches are often completely deserted which will offer you the best opportunity for seclusion, romance, and simple beach strolling with no one around but you and the surf. Its the perfect locations for those who seek isolation from the world and the crowds.
